#3a5b6d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3a5b6d is composed of 22.7% red, 35.7%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.8%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 201.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.5% and a lightness of 32.7%. #3a5b6d color hex could be obtained by blending #74b6da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#3a5b6d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030507 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a5b6d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d555a is the less saturated color, while #006ca7 is the most saturated one.
